Citrus Tangerina (Tangerine) Extract
Citrus Tangerina (Tangerine) Extract is derived from the fruit and peel of the tangerine (mandarin orange, Citrus tangerina). It is notable for its polymethoxylated flavones — nobiletin and tangeretin — which are potent antioxidants with additional anti-inflammatory activity. The extract also provides hesperidin (a citrus bioflavonoid), carotenoids, and vitamin C precursors. Used as the headline active in Korean 'Vita C' skincare formulas (notably Goodal's Green Tangerine line) for antioxidant protection and skin brightening.

Watch for
- ⚠Citrus extracts can be phototoxic if they contain furanocoumarins — tangerine has low furanocoumarin content compared to bergamot or lime, but patch test recommended for sensitive skin
